Seen this place a couple of times and finally decided to give it a try. Was greeted the second we came in amazingly friendly staff! Maybe had about three minute wait as they set up our table, it was our first time and they were very helpful with the menu. We started off with one of their signature micheladas and a pelon pelo which is a two micheladas but in a huge candy container which you get to keep! Great flavor perfect mixture of beer in Clamato!! Started with the fried calamari as an appetizer. Perfect breading didn't really need the sauce included. You can choose to have the bell peppers with it or not feel like adding the bell peppers we didn't get much calamari it was more like a fried bell pepper plate. We ordered two of their bowls or they can come in bags so you could pick which is a great option. The first one we got was lobster, shrimp crawfish, potatoes, and sausage with cali Cajun and mild spicy. Flavor was amazing. I did not need lemon food stayed hot the whole time we were eating. The second bowl we ordered was snow, grab shrimp, clams, sausage, potato, and hard boiled eggs. This was the best crab I have ever ate! Cook to perfection perfect seasoning very moist not overcooked at all. Shrimp is not baby shrimp you actually get a lot of shrimp! The potatoes I feel were just okay nothing really special I would skip those next time but the corn and egg were perfect! The egg was the added soaking in the juices just made it so perfect. Would definitely go again and try the other three flavors they have to offer. If you want a fun night with drinks and amazing sea food come here. Also they have little drinks for the kids with hello kitty. So even the little ones or just in general if you don't want to drink they have fun options! Family owned definitely check this place out if you're in Orange!!

We have been frequent patrons at killer crab near south coast plaza and our original plan for our party of 9 was to go there but there was a 2.5 hour wait. My son found this place on yelp and we called and they told us that there was no wait at 7pm on a Sunday night. We drove up and saw that the restaurant is located in the Main Place Mall near the discovery science cube. Other than one table the entire restaurant was empty which was a little suspicious. We sat down and the menu was similar to the one from killer crab. We ordered a calamari for appetizer and the. Most of us ordered shrimp and crawfish and a couple of people ordered grilled shrimp tacos. The sauces tasted good but were much oilier or greasier than the one that we are used to. You have the option of getting your grump without shell which costs about $6 more a pound. Patrons started to roll in at 7:30 and by 7:30 there we a total of 7 parties and the restaurant was about 50% full. Our server was Michelle who was very nice but overall the service is super slow compared to other busier places that want to turn over the table. Overall food was 4/5, service 4/5, ambience 3/5. . After we received our bill, I had to change my score. They charged us different prices that were on the menu. They charged us more for the shrimp and the excuse was that prices have gone up and they charge market prices which is not what the menu said. Only crab and lobster were shown as market price. They also charged us for the sauces that comes with the food even though, again the menu didn’t say anything about extra change for the sauces and other Cajun shrimp places like killer shrimp never charge extra for the sauces! Our server adjusted the prices after we complained.

Last weekend, Yelp recommended Cali Licious to me. It sounded right up our alley but we were recovering from a late night in Hollywood and getting off the couch seemed like too much effort, so I stored it in my "places to try" for a later time. Fat forward to tonight and after we had the regular "cook or order" Friday night conversation, I knew exactly where to go. Cali Licious is located at Mainplace Mall down at the 24 hour fitness end off of Main Street. As soon as we walked in, we were greeted warmly and informed as a family owned restaurant, we were now part of the family. The service was outstanding. Everyone was super friendly and attentive. We ordered king crab legs and shrimp and added sausage. We chose the mix de todo sauce, mild sauce. We also ordered Cajun fries and garlic bread. They offer bibs and gloves and have the perfect napkin dispensers for those who opt to go gloveless. Our food was served quickly and piping hot. The crab legs were ginormous and full of flavor. We asked for a side of the medium sauce, which we ended up dipping everything in. I 100% could've just sat with a bowl of the sauce and a side of garlic bread.. it was the perfect combo. My husband (the crab aficionado) was completely content having the crab legs mostly to himself. We will absolutely be back again soon so we can try the mussels, extra picante sauce and their Michelle's. Thanks for inviting us into the family.. we're happy to be here!
